ASHEVILLE, NC
Little Jumbo
Five Points, in the old Jenkins grocery — the room bartenders name when you ask where they drink.

Sunday nights end in trivia here; Wednesday nights end in board games. DumbAshe Trivia runs the Sunday quiz for a shot at bar credit that tops out around fifty dollars, and the games come out again on Wednesdays, boards and dice and cards laid along the tables. Chall Gray and Jay Sanders opened Little Jumbo at 241 Broadway on November 7, 2017, fifty-four seats split between a front banquette, low and high tables, and the bar itself, over the original battered floorboards. Gray took the bar’s name from Harry Johnson, the nineteenth-century bartender whose 1882 manual argued a drink should come out fast and a guest should be looked after. The menu runs nine sections deep. The Old Fashioneds alone come four ways, an 1870s build and a 1930s one among them. The Martini Club follows, and two drinks get pages built for sharing — a Manhattan Service, a Japanese Highball — each one poured for two. Elsewhere the names do the talking: Tattletale, Creature Negroni, Midnight Bouquet, the last one built on añejo tequila and mezcal, finished with grapefruit bitters. The snack plate — olives, tomato confit, marinated mushrooms — landed on the menu this August, borrowed from what Character Study already had. The walls are exposed brick, hung with art that rotates, under a run of vintage furniture. Card games run long some Wednesdays. Go on a Wednesday if trivia isn’t your speed — the cards keep going until somebody decides they’re done.
